Gas Stations within 2 miles near Needham, MA
click anywhere on map to change location
Gas Stations within 2 miles near Needham, MA
2025-03-02
Roadnow
- MAP
Arbuckle Mobil
, 0.44mi
Needham,MA
Map | Nearby Points of interest - MAP
Dedham Avenue Automotive
, 1.26mi
Needham,MA
Map | Nearby Points of interest - MAP
Needham Service Center
, 1.61mi
Needham,MA
Map | Nearby Points of interest - MAP
Needham Oil CO Incorporated
, 1.62mi
Needham,MA
Map | Nearby Points of interest - MAP
Ange's Shell Svc Station
, 1.68mi
Dedham,MA
Map | Nearby Points of interest - MAP
Dedham Getty
, 1.69mi
Dedham,MA
Map | Nearby Points of interest - MAP
Bacchiochi Mobil
, 1.74mi
Needham,MA
Map | Nearby Points of interest - MAP
Hess Gas Station
, 1.78mi
Dedham,MA
Map | Nearby Points of interest - MAP
Amerada Hess Corporation
, 1.78mi
Dedham,MA
Map | Nearby Points of interest - MAP
Pam's Market
, 1.79mi
Dedham,MA
Map | Nearby Points of interest - MAP
Ames Street Sunoco
, 1.81mi
Dedham,MA
Map | Nearby Points of interest - MAP
Parkway Mobil Auto Repair Incorporated
, 1.88mi
West Roxbury,MA
Map | Nearby Points of interest - MAP
Spring Street Petroleum
, 1.99mi
West Roxbury,MA
Map | Nearby Points of interest - MAP
Needham Heights Shell
, 1.99mi
Needham,MA
Map | Nearby Points of interest